WebSo you should sell your car instead of trading it in if the sales price is less than your adjusted basis. Selling a business vehicle: A few exceptions. The above example assumes you use the car 100 percent for business. If you use it less than 100 percent, you may only deduct the business portion of your loss. Subject to two exceptions, you can ...
